Your Role: Join our team at MilliporeSigma, a leading science and technology company and key player in safeguarding the food supply through development of cutting-edge food safety solutions. We are currently looking for a passionate R&D Scientist to join our BioMonitoring R&D team at our Laclede facility in St. Louis, MO with expertise in Applied Microbiology. The BioMonitoring R&D organization develops innovative solutions for our customers: microbiology quality-control laboratories in the food, beverage, and pharmaceutical industries. In this role, you will play a crucial part in expanding our food pathogen diagnostics portfolio, supporting development projects, and contributing to our BioMonitoring strategy. As a member of our global cross-functional team, you will have the opportunity to help drive innovative projects, analyze data, and engage in scientific discussions.
